- Summary
- "Configuration of Cisco devices (e.g. routers and switches) has traditionally been performed at the command line. However, an industry-wide paradigm shift is now underway, where more and more configuration is being performed by software, an approach commonly referred to as Software Defined Networking (SDN). SDN is an emerging architecture that is makes it easier and more cost-effective to implement network policies and manage network resources. It does this by decoupling the network control from the network hardware (which continues to manage forwarding functions), allowing network control to become directly programmable and the underlying network infrastructure to be managed by applications and network services rather than individually configured. Network Programmability Fundamentals LiveLessons introduces the theory surrounding SDN networks and examines components found in a Cisco ACI network. Additionally, this course covers Python programming, a key skill required for network programmability. Finally, this course walks through multiple network programmability exercises, which can be performed (for free) at Cisco's DevNet site."--Resource description page
